Overview Pantave 40mg Tablet
AcidGard 40mg tablets diminish stomach acid production. This medication treats stomach and intestinal conditions like heartburn, acid reflux, peptic ulcers, and Zollinger-Ellison syndrome, relieving symptoms and fostering healing. AcidGard 40mg also prevents stomach ulcers and acidity potentially caused by long-term painkiller use. A proton pump inhibitor (PPI), it's best taken one hour before meals, ideally in the morning. Dosage depends on your condition and response; continue as prescribed even with symptom relief. Smaller, more frequent meals and avoiding caffeine, spicy, and fatty foods can enhance treatment. Common, usually mild, side effects include nausea, vomiting, headache, dizziness, gas, diarrhea, and stomach ache. Persistent or bothersome side effects warrant medical attention. Prolonged use (over a year) may increase bone fracture risk, particularly at higher doses. Discuss bone loss prevention, such as calcium and vitamin D supplements, with your doctor. Inform your physician of severe liver disease, HIV medication use, prior allergic reactions to similar drugs, or existing osteoporosis before starting AcidGard 40mg. This is also crucial for pregnant or breastfeeding individuals.

How to use Pantave 40mg Tablet:
Follow your doctor's instructions precisely regarding dosage and treatment length for this medication. Ingest the 40mg Pantave t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or breaking it. Administer on an empty stomach.
How Pantave 40mg Tablet works:
Stomach acid is neutralized by Pantave 40mg tablets, a proton pump inhibitor (PPI), thereby alleviating heartburn and acid indigestion.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Consuming alcohol alongside Pantave 40mg Tablet is inadvisable.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Pantave 40m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the unborn child. A physician will assess the adv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ice before using this medication.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Breastfeeding mothers can likely use Pantave 40mg tablets without significant risk. Available human data indicates minimal danger to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ving ability may be impaired by side effects associated with Pantave 40mg Tablets.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Pantave 40mg tablets are considered safe for individuals with kidney impairment. No alteration to the Pantave 40mg tablet dosage is necessary.
LiverCAUTION
For patients with severe hepatic impairment, Pantave 40mg tablets require careful administration.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is recommended.
What if you forget to take Pantave 40mg Tablet :
Should you forget a Pantave 40mg Tablet dose, take it immediately. If your next dose is imminent, however,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.
